function Get-PfaChartData {
    <#
    .SYNOPSIS
    Retrieves all necessary data and preformats for New-PfaChart.
 
    .DESCRIPTION
    Uses Invoke-PfaApiRequest to retrieve data from Array that is preformatted for New-PfaChart.
 
    .PARAMETER Array
    FlashArray object to query.
 
    .PARAMETER Credential
    Username and Password needed for authentication.
 
    .PARAMETER Type
    Specifies the type of chart. Acceptable values are:
        Dashboard
        Performance
        Capacity
        Replication
     
    .PARAMETER ChartName
    Dynamic Parameter: Specifies the chart name. Only available if Type is Dashboard. Acceptable values are:
        Overview
        Capacity
 
    .PARAMETER Group
    Dynamic Parameter: Specifies the chart group. Acceptable values are dependent on which Type is specified.
        Type: Performance
            Group can be Array, Volume, Volumes, Volume Groups, and File System, Pods, Directories
        Type: Capacity
            Group can be Array, Volumes, Volume Groups, Pods, and Directories
        Type: Replication
            Group can be Array or Volume
 
    .PARAMETER Historical
    Specify a different timespan for chart. Acceptable values are 5m, 1h, 3h, 24h, 7d, 30d, 90d, and 1y. Only valid on Performance, Capacity, and Replication Charts.
 
    .PARAMETER Filter
    This parameter is here for future usage (hopefully). Not all API queries support this option. Currently, none used by Get-PfaChartData qualify.
 
    .PARAMETER Name
    This parameter is used to limit queries to specific names.
 
    .PARAMETER ApiVersion
    Optional parameter to specify the REST API version to interact with.
 
    .EXAMPLE
    Retrieve data to create a chart that resembles the "Dashboard -> Capacity" in the Purity//FA UI
    $DashboardMetrics = Get-PfaChartData -Array $FlashArray -Type Dashboard -ChartName Capacity
 
    .EXAMPLE
    Retrieve data to create a chart that resembles the "Storage -> ArrayName" in the Purity//FA UI
    $DashboardMetrics = Get-PfaChartData -Array $FlashArray -Type Dashboard -ChartName Overview
 
    .NOTES
    Author: brandon said
    #>
